NK cell therapy for high-risk neuroblastoma in children
Part of Cancer clinical trials.
This trial tests a new natural killer (NK) cell therapy from donated umbilical cord blood for children with high-risk neuroblastoma that has come back or not responded to treatment. The goal is to see if this immune cell therapy is safe and can help fight the cancer.

Who can take part
- Age 18 or younger, any gender.
- Diagnosed with high-risk neuroblastoma that has come back or not responded to treatment.
- Must have had previous treatments like surgery, chemo, and possibly radiation or stem cell transplant.
- General health and blood counts must be within certain limits (e.g., enough white blood cells, platelets, etc.).
- No major heart, lung, or bleeding problems, and no active infections or other cancers.
